The Role of Optical Brighteners in the Plastic Pallet (Pallet Plastik) Industry

One additive that plays a significant role in enhancing the appearance of plastic pallets is the optical brightener. This substance helps elevate surface brightness, improve aesthetic appeal, and enhance perceived product quality without affecting the mechanical performance of the pallet. As competition in logistics and warehousing intensifies, optical brighteners have become a valued component in premium pallet production.
What Are Optical Brighteners?
Also known as fluorescent whitening agents (FWAs)—are chemical additives that absorb ultraviolet (UV) light and re-emit it as visible blue light. This reaction gives plastic products a brighter, cleaner, and more vivid look. Originally used in textiles and detergents, optical brighteners are now widely applied in polymer-based industries, including plastic packaging, consumer goods, and industrial materials such as plastic pallets.
In pallet manufacturing, the most commonly used optical brighteners belong to the stilbene and coumarin derivative family, chosen for their strong whitening effects and good compatibility with thermoplastic resins.
Why Optical Brighteners Are Used in Plastic Pallets
- Enhancing Surface Appearance
Plastic pallets often undergo rough handling in supply chains, making appearance an important criterion for brand perception. This additive give pallets a cleaner and more polished look, which is especially valuable for industries requiring high sanitation and visual standards, such as:
- Food and beverage
- Pharmaceutical and medical storage
- Cosmetic distribution
- Improving Color Consistency
In certain applications, especially where virgin and regrind materials are blended, color variations may occur. This additive help mask slight yellowish or dull tones in the resin, resulting in:
- More consistent batch-to-batch color
- A fresher and brighter finish
- Reduced visual defects on the pallet surface
This makes quality control easier and reduces rejection rates.
- Enhancing Perceived Cleanliness
Industries with strict hygiene protocols often prefer bright-colored or white plastic pallets. This additive amplify the whiteness effect, making the pallet look more sanitary and easier to inspect. This visual benefit supports stricter compliance standards in:
- Cleanrooms
- Cold storage facilities
- Pharmaceutical warehouses
How Optical Brighteners Work in Pallet Production
- Mixing with Resin
Optical brighteners are typically added during:
- Injection molding
- Compression molding
- Extrusion-based pallet manufacturing
The dosage is usually low (often below 0.1%), ensuring efficiency without affecting pallet strength or durability.
- Stability Under Processing Temperatures
Plastic pallet production often involves high temperatures ranging from 180°C to 260°C. Quality optical brighteners are designed to remain stable under heat and maintain performance without degradation.
- Compatibility with Polymer Types
This additive are compatible with common pallet materials, such as:
- High-density polyethylene (HDPE)
- Polypropylene (PP)
- Recycled polymer blends
This flexibility allows manufacturers to use optical brighteners across multiple pallet designs and production processes.
Advantages for Manufacturers
- ost-Effective Aesthetic Enhancement
Optical brighteners provide a powerful visual upgrade at a relatively low cost, making them one of the most economical additives for improving product appearance.
- Better Market Differentiation
A brighter, visually appealing pallet can distinguish a brand in a competitive market. Customers often associate brighter pallets with:
- Higher quality
- Better hygiene
- More modern production standards
- Supports Recycling Programs
When recycled material introduces color inconsistencies, optical brighteners help balance the final appearance—allowing manufacturers to utilize more recycled content without compromising visual quality.
